Since even George Bush thinks Hillary Clinton is the inevitable Democratic presidential nominee, that seems to wrap up the convention wisdom. But the most talked-about piece dealing with this phenomenon takes an opposite tack: that Clinton is no sure-bet.
The NYT's Adam Nagourney writes: "The truth is, there is no evidence that the Democratic primary voters have fallen head-over-heels for Mrs Clinton. And any event that reminds Democratic voters of the lingering concerns about her could topple her from her perch."
